While this F9F Panther EDF is not for beginner flyers, it is perfect for the intermediate flyer looking for their first EDF jet. There is not an easier EDF jet to fly. Unlike many EDF jets, the Freewing F9F actually floats for an extended period of time without throttle (assuming a correct CG). The F9F is powerful enough to loop and has a fantastic roll rate. We recommend hand launching and belly landing in the grass for pilots new to EDF jets. The F9F is built from durable EPO foam and uses nylon hinges. While a 1600 mAh LiPo is recommended, a 2200 mAh battery can be used by more experienced pilots with minor modification to the battery compartment. We highly recommend a high wing trainer for beginners and proficiency with at least one low wing plane before attempting to fly an EDF jet. Note: Please sand the paint off on the fuselage and wing surface prior to gluing together. Wingspan 700mm/27.6in Length 745mm/29.3in Flying Weight 550g Power System Brushless 2627-4500kV Outrunner Motor Speed Control 30A, Internal BEC, XT60 connector Propeller / EDF 64mm 5-Blade EDF Servos 9g digital standard with 100mm lead : elevator 9g digital standard with 300mm lead : left aileron, right aileron Landing Gear none - belly lander (optional gear is available) Required Battery 3S 11.1V 1600mAh 25C 3 cell LiPo Required Radio 3 Channel Rudder No Flaps No Ailerons Yes Lights No Hinge Type Nylon hinges on all control surfaces Material EPO Foam
